9 Richmond Road is a mature semi-detached house offering accommodation over two floors, the accommodation is complimented by a UPVC double glazed Conservatory.
A UPVC double glazed door gives access to the Entrance Hall, with stairs extending to first floor and useful cupboard under.
The Cloakroom comprises a two piece suite, and adjacent is a deep fitted cloaks cupboard.
Overlooking the rear garden is the Sitting Room with a Victorian style fireplace housing an electric coal effect fire. The Kitchen/ Dining Room has a front aspect window and French doors leading into the Conservatory. There are a range of modern base and wall units providing cupboard and drawer storage complimented by work surfaces and tiled splashbacks. Built in appliances include the electric oven, four ring gas hob with cooker hood above and there is plumbing for a dishwasher. The stainless steel sink sits beneath the front facing window.
The UPVC double glazed Conservatory has a polycarbonate roof, and sliding patio doors. Off the Kitchen is the generous Utility Room with a window overlooking the rear garden and door to same. Range of base and wall units with worktop, plumbing for washing machine and space for tumble-dryer.
On the first floor landing a window provides natural light, Bedrooms 1 & 2 both overlook the rear garden. The generous 3rd Bedroom enjoys a front aspect view and the Bathroom Suite comprises the panelled bath with mixer tap/ shower attachment, pedestal wash hand basin, low level WC and a cupboard houses the hot water cylinder.
The property is approached via a pedestrian path with wrought iron gate leading into the Front Garden being lawned with well stocked flower shrub beds and borders.
The fully enclosed Rear Garden comprises an extensive patio adjacent to the Conservatory and timber shed with the remainder of garden being lawned with well stocked shrub borders including an established apple tree.
